What Exactly is a Crypto BBQ?
A crypto BBQ is an informal in-person gathering where blockchain enthusiasts, investors, and curious newcomers connect over grilled food. Unlike formal conferences, these events prioritize relaxed conversations in parks, backyards, or rooftop spaces. Attendees might discuss:
- Market trends while seasoning steaks
- New DeFi protocols as charcoal heats up
- NFT projects during burger flipping sessions
- Wallet security tips over cold drinks
The fusion of food and finance breaks down barriers, making complex topics approachable. It’s community building with a side of coleslaw!

How to Host Your Own Unforgettable Crypto BBQ
Ready to fire up the grill and the conversation? Follow this 6-step checklist:
- Location Logistics: Choose a public park with picnic tables or a spacious backyard. Ensure reliable Wi-Fi or hotspot access for live portfolio checks!
- Crypto-Themed Menu: Serve “Blockchain Brisket,” “Satoshi Sliders,” or “HODL Hot Dogs.” Include vegan options for diverse diets.
- Engagement Activities: Organize lightning talks, wallet setup stations, or a “Shill-Free” project pitch corner.
- Safety First: Use QR codes for contactless sign-ins and set clear COVID/security protocols.
- Promotion: Announce on crypto calendars, Discord servers, and local Web3 meetup groups 2-3 weeks ahead.
- Post-Event Follow-Up: Share photos (with consent!) and create a Telegram group to maintain momentum.

Crypto BBQ FAQ: Your Questions Answered
Q: Do I need crypto knowledge to attend?
A: Not at all! BBQs welcome everyone – perfect for curious newcomers.
Q: How are these funded?
A: Some are community-funded (attendees chip in crypto), others sponsored by local Web3 projects.
Q: Can I promote my crypto project?
A: Focus on organic conversations rather than sales pitches. Bring business cards with wallet addresses!
Q: What if it rains?
A: Have a backup plan like a covered pavilion or postpone using decentralized voting apps.
Q: Are these events global?
A: Absolutely! From Austin to Berlin, search #CryptoBBQ on social media to find local events.
